1.
Introduction
2.
Why use the PH editor?
3.
User Manual
3.1.
Getting Started
3.2.
Anatomy of the Editor
3.3.
The Chart Manager
3.3.1.
Managing Charts
3.3.2.
Managing Songs
3.3.3.
Verifying and Uploading Songs
3.4.
Saving and Auto-Saving
3.5.
Settings and their Managers
3.5.1.
Global Settings
3.5.2.
Per-Song Settings
3.5.3.
Shortcuts
3.6.
The Chart Preview
3.6.1.
The Grid
3.6.2.
Playtesting a chart
3.6.3.
Slowdowns and Speedups
3.7.
The Inspector
3.7.1.
Common Properties
3.7.2.
Editing Properties
3.7.3.
Copying Properties
3.8.
The Timeline
3.8.1.
The Playhead
3.8.2.
Tempo Maps and the Sync Module
3.8.3.
Layers and Visibility
3.8.4.
Creating and Selecting Notes
3.8.4.1.
Modifying Notes
3.8.4.2.
Advanced Selection Tools
3.8.5.
Moving Selections Around
3.9.
Arranging Tools
3.9.1.
Arranging in the Preview
3.9.2.
Autoplacing
3.9.3.
The Arrange Wheel
3.9.4.
Arranging in Circles
3.9.5.
Flips and Mirrors
3.9.6.
Rotations
3.10.
Angle Tools
3.10.1.
Angles and Oscillations
3.10.2.
Editing Angles in the Preview
3.10.3.
Automatic Angles
3.10.4.
Angle Increments
3.10.5.
Angle Modifiers
3.11.
Multinote Presets
3.11.1.
Verticals and Horizontals
3.11.2.
Quads
3.11.3.
Triangles
3.12.
Managing Events and Lyrics
3.12.1.
Speed Changes
3.12.2.
Intro Skip
3.12.3.
Lyrics
3.12.4.
Sections
3.13.
The Scripts Manager
3.14.
Importing Charts
3.14.1.
DSC/DIVA Charts
3.14.2.
F2nd Edits
3.14.3.
PPD Charts
3.14.4.
CSFM/Comfy Charts
3.14.5.
MIDI Files
4.
Developer Reference
4.1.
Scripts and Expressions
4.1.1.
Scripting Reference
4.1.2.
Advanced Uses of Expressions
4.2.
Common Data Types
4.2.1.
Timing Points
4.2.1.1.
HBTimingPoint
4.2.1.2.
HBBaseNote
4.2.1.3.
HBNoteData
4.2.1.4.
HBDoubleNote
4.2.1.5.
HBSustainNote
4.2.1.6.
HBTimingChange
4.2.1.7.
HBBPMChange
4.2.1.8.
HBChartSection
4.2.1.9.
HBIntroSkipMarker
4.2.2.
HBChart
4.2.3.
HBSong
4.2.4.
ScriptRunnerScript
4.2.5.
HBEditor
Light (default)
Rust
Coal
Navy
Ayu
PH Editor Reference Manual
Layers and Visibility